ADATA technology allegedly hacked as reported by RansomHouse ransomware with description: ADATA technology Co., Ltd. info Founded in May 2001, ADATA technology Co., Ltd. is committed to providing top-notch memory solutions that enrich the customer's digital life. The company's dedication to unity and professionalism has made ADATA the leading memory brand with the most award-winning product designs.
